Ecatepec
Ecatepec, Mexico, is a vibrant municipality located just northeast of Mexico City. Known for its rich history, diverse culture, and unique attractions, it offers travelers an authentic Mexican experience. The area boasts a blend of modern amenities and traditional charm, making it suitable for those interested in exploring local life beyond typical tourist spots. An ideal visit would span 2–3 days, allowing time to immerse in its offerings.

Highlights & Things to Do in Ecatepec
-
Sacred Heart of Jesus Cathedral: A modernist church inaugurated in 1999, known for its unique architecture and cultural significance. (en.wikipedia.org)
-
Iglesia de San Cristóbal: Dating back to 1562, this historic church offers insights into the area's colonial past. (es.wikipedia.org)
-
Casa de la Cultura "José Ma. Morelos y Pavón": A cultural center offering workshops and exhibitions that showcase local art and history. (es.wikipedia.org)
-
Parque Estatal Sierra de Guadalupe: A large state park featuring hiking trails, picnic areas, and opportunities for rock climbing. (en.wikivoyage.org)
-
Multiplaza Aragón: A shopping center with over 400 stores, including hypermarkets and a movie theater, catering to diverse shopping preferences. (en.wikipedia.org)
